***Christopher Malayalam Movie Review***

Directed by Unnikrishnan B starring Mammootty in lead role.

Also starring Amala Paul, Aishwarya Lekshmi , Sneha , Dileesh Pothan, Shine Tom Chacko

Always the dice doesn't throw 12 , post watching i felt.

Positivity of the Movie....

1) Mammootty, Mammootty, Mammootty...Its just him. It will be difficult for a cinematographer to take the best shot as evey shot he comes, it just awesome. He delivered the best & that he will do when he has the worst script.

2) BGM was good

3) Unnikrishnan Sir film making was quite different. Some shots seems to remind me of your Shaji Kailas sir. Making wise he tried to cover up the age old topic & that efforts needs to be appreciated

4) Amala Paul gave a fair performance.

5) No songs, no unnecessary comedy made the watchable.

Negativity of the Movie

1) Rapes, violence against women is serious, grave topic but thats not an overnight story. Its happening since years then why in 2023 , this topic needs to be highlighted???

2) Predictability observed in many areas including the climax

3) Logical issues behind executing a murder.

4) Villian performance seems to remind me of his character in Etharkum Thunindhavan movie.

5) Aishwarya Lekshmi character was just an unnecessary addition just to drag the story further. No notable performance from her side.

6) Sarath Kumar, Sneha, Siddique and many more but there were just having an extended cameo appearance. An actor like Sarath Kumar why not out of disrespect but it has to be something strong in character when taking his date.

Overall if Aarattu was a celebration of the Mohanlal stardom, here the writer Uday Krishnan and B Unnikrishnan exploited the stardom of Mammootty but came to be an average.

"Christopher" Review by M. Siraj. Mamootty's never dying thirst for distinctive acting.
rafathsiraj11 February 2023
Christopher Review by M. Siraj. Mamootty's never dying thirst for distinctive acting.

Those who loves mass thriller films, Mammootty's "Christopher" fills their excitement and anticipation.

Its stylish teasers and theme songs were made a hysteria of anxiety, director flourished in satisfying their expectations with a perfect thrilling entertainment package that validates it. Director has made this film with such speed and technical perfection that we don't want to take our eyes off the screen. Christopher is a senior IPS officer who has a reputation of having lot of fan-following on social media, for his strong belief on delayed justice is injustice and for encounter the accused people in rape cases before trials.

The film narrates the story of him, played by megastar Mammootty with the tag line Biography of a Vigilante Cop, who punishes criminals in a vigilante model with his own law as his justice, director succeeded in telling the story in a non-linear way mixing present and past of his life more convincingly.

We can comprehend Director B Unnikrishnan's excellence through this mass gripping film who always has a special talent for making stylish investigation thrillers, while writer Udaya Krishna has penned a tight, loop-holed rousing screenplay, Director's mode of sculpting the Christopher character can be said to be the film's biggest success.

Throughout the film, the director has managed to tell the story by combining all the entertainment elements, that Christopher stands out for being able to present the audience in a very funny and trendy way, despite dealing with a lot of social issues, it touches on the present viral subject of violence against women and harassment against them with piercing strong punchy dialogues.

Needless to say, footing of this film is the mass performance of Mammootty only, who gave life to his character very sophisticatedly and coolly, director very meticulously used Mammootty's stardom as an actor very beautifully in this. His patting on the shoulders of victims with his hand, director gives a clear indication to the audience what is going to happen to the accused. While listening the agonies of the victim Mamootty's facial expressions in side angle shot, his chin shrinks and expands clearly essays Mamootty's inner feelings, Oh My God, even 100 pages of dialogue cannot give the effect, Mamootty express it in a single 30 seconds' frame.

While Mammootty's energy and screen presence as Christopher is worth mentioning, Vinay Rai as an antagonist gets applause, in every scene he appears, Aishwarya Lakshmi, Sneha and Amala Paul have also given life to their characters in an attention-grabbing manner in this film.

The cool visuals and thrilling background music is another element that stood out the best in this highly technical thriller film.

There are some minor setbacks in this film, lack of ability to find interesting or new ideas, it is almost like they want to show Mammootty the star in more slow-motion walks and the pattern is highly predictable.

Keeping aside the negligible short falls, in brief, Christopher is a mass entertainer that exhilarates and excites from beginning to end with a good movie experience for the audience.

The bar for director B. Unnikrishnan and writer Udaykrishna is set so low to begin with, anything even marginally better will come across as tolerable. Christopher is a film that should have released in the mid 2000s, and audiences would've lapped it up. If you keep Faiz Siddik's interesting choice of frames and Justin Varghese's stylish score aside, Christopher has nothing to offer. With a script this sterile, the ensemble cast (including Mammootty) doesn't even try. From beginning to end, there's the repetitive format of a heinous crime (against women) taking place, Christopher learning about it, and he instantly goes after the culprits and offs them. Someone should seriously tell Udaykrishna and B. Unnikrishnan that depicting graphic rape scenes over and over doesn't make their film gritty. So many rapes, so many murders. We get the point, duh!
